People & Places Of Interest: What Are You Looking Out For?

With the candidates announced, and campaigning in full swing - we take a look at the major battles, hot seats and big names that will be contesting in GE15. To start, we look back on reactions to nomination day, and what the main takeaways are now that we officially know who will be running in each constituency. Then we ask you, the listener, what you're looking out for in the lead-up to polling day.
